Prettiest beach in Florida?

I don't have a specific beach, but thus far, I found the Emerald Coast--in particular Destin to be gorgeous. The water is a perfect shade of green, at least on our visit. (until it is packed with tourists that is).

I live in Brevard and our water isn't clear at all--a bit dingy from all the sand getting stirred up with the tides. I wouldn't call it "pretty". But it's nice.
 
The Destin area is my favorite. I love the white sand.
 
The stretch of 30A between Panama City Beach and Destin. The sand is very white, the beaches are CLEAN and the water is very clear and like the Caribbean

We love going to Port St. Joe, its about an hour/hour and a half from Panama City Beach. The place we normally stay is right next to the National Park which has amazing snorkling on one side of the peninsula and perfect recreational conditions on the other.

I think Destin rivals the Caribbean in terms of beauty. We had always vacationed in the Sanibel/Naples region, which I thought was nice. Then we visited Destin and were blown away. It is soooo much prettier than further south.

We went in October and it was practically deserted, yet still 75-80 degrees each day. And it is so much closer to travelers than southern Florida. Too bad it's not warm in the winter or else we would always choose Destin over Ft. Myers Beach.
